  1. Day 1: Visit the Kashi Vishwanath Temple Complex
    Located in the heart of Varanasi
    Estimated time from previous location: 0 minutes

    The Kashi Vishwanath Temple Complex is one of the holiest and most revered sites in Hinduism, attracting pilgrims from all over India. The complex houses the main Kashi Vishwanath Temple along with several smaller temples and shrines dedicated to various deities. The temple's striking architecture and intricate carvings are a testament to India's rich cultural heritage. Visitors should dress modestly and remove shoes before entering the temple. It's best to visit early in the morning to avoid the crowds and to witness the daily aarti ceremony.

  2. Day 2: Take a Boat Ride on the Ganges River
    Starting point: Dashashwamedh Ghat
    Estimated time from previous location: 10 minutes by foot (0.5 miles)

    One of the quintessential Varanasi experiences is taking a boat ride on the Ganges River. From the water, visitors can witness the daily rituals and ceremonies that take place on the ghats (steps leading to the river). The most popular time to take a boat ride is at dawn when the river is shrouded in mist and the ghats are bathed in a soft golden light. Make sure to negotiate the price with the boatman beforehand and bring sunscreen and a hat.

  3. Day 3: Explore the Sarnath Archaeological Site
    Located 7 miles northeast of Varanasi
    Estimated time from previous location: 20 minutes by car (7 miles)

    Sarnath is an important Buddhist pilgrimage site where Lord Buddha delivered his first sermon after attaining enlightenment. The site contains several ancient stupas, temples, and monasteries, as well as a museum showcasing artifacts from the Mauryan and Gupta periods.
